I play a mud called Medievia a lot and they have a great pk system that could easily be used in Planeshift.
The world is divided in lawful-pk, neutral-pk and chaotic-pk zones ( LPK, NPK and CPK for short).
- in LPK, you can\'t attack or harm other players in any way. In these zones, you are toatally safe from other players.
- in NPK, you can attack other players, but when one of you dies, they don\'t suffer a real death, they are just teleported ,with just a few hp, to the closest LPK area, in a shielded room. Mobs in this areas also give more xp than they would in Lpk, thus people often gather here to xp and pk.
To prevent mass newbie pk, a marking system has been added, so when you pk someone you get \"blood\" on your hands. This means that you can get attacked anywhere by anybody for a certain ammount of time, which depends on the difference in levels between you and your victim. So, if u were a lvl 100 player and you killed a lvl 4 newb, the mark would last for a very long time, maybe even a few hours, but if you killed a lvl 150 player, you would only get marked for a few minutes. This marking system also prevents players from pking at the edge of the NPk zone and then running out to rest and regain hp or mana.
- Finally in the CPK zone you can pk anybody without penalty. They will suffer a real death in this zone and you will also be able to loot the corpse for about 2 minutes until it dissapears. The mobs in CPk give even more xp than in Npk and usually, rare and powerful eq can be found in this areas.
